The Basics: What Exactly Is Talcum Powder? 🧐🔍

Talcum powder, commonly known as baby powder, is made from talc, a mineral composed mainly of magnesium, silicon, and oxygen. When ground into a fine powder, talc can absorb moisture, reduce friction, and prevent rashes. This makes it an ideal product for keeping skin dry and comfortable, especially for babies. 🍼👶

Beyond Babies: Adult Uses of Talcum Powder 🧑‍🦳🌟

While talcum powder is often linked to baby care, it has several practical applications for adults too. Here are a few ways adults can benefit from using talcum powder:

  • Foot Care: Sprinkle some talcum powder in your socks or shoes to keep your feet dry and odor-free. Perfect for those long days on your feet! 🦶👟
  • Skin Irritations: Talcum powder can soothe minor skin irritations and prevent chafing, making it a great addition to your post-workout routine. 🏋️‍♀️🔥
  • Makeup Application: Use a light dusting of talcum powder to set your makeup and prevent it from smudging throughout the day. It’s a beauty hack that works wonders! 💄✨
  • Hair Care: Talcum powder can absorb excess oil in your hair, giving you a quick refresh between washes. It’s a lifesaver for those second-day hair moments! 🙃💇‍♀️

The Controversy: Is Talcum Powder Safe? 🧐🚨

Despite its widespread use, talcum powder has faced scrutiny over the years. Concerns about potential links to cancer, particularly ovarian cancer and lung issues, have led to lawsuits and warnings from health organizations. The main issue is the presence of asbestos, a carcinogenic substance that can sometimes contaminate talc. 🛑🚫

However, many talcum powder brands now use talc that is asbestos-free, and the scientific community remains divided on the risks. To stay safe, opt for talcum powders that are clearly labeled as asbestos-free and use them in well-ventilated areas. 🌬️✅

The Future of Talcum Powder: Natural Alternatives 🌿🌟

As consumers become more health-conscious, there’s a growing trend towards natural alternatives to talcum powder. Products made from cornstarch, arrowroot powder, and baking soda are gaining popularity due to their gentle and hypoallergenic properties. These options provide similar benefits without the potential risks associated with talc. 🍞🌱
